Abstract
Illustrative methods and systems described herein use lightmaps to present 3D graphics. For example, a method includes identifying a viewpoint within a 3D scene and receiving a dynamic lightmap for an object represented by a 3D model in the 3D scene. The identified viewpoint is selected by a user of a media player device presenting the 3D scene to the user and the dynamic lightmap is generated or updated at a first level of detail determined based on the identified viewpoint. The method further includes rendering an image for presentation to the user from the identified viewpoint. This rendering of the image includes rendering the 3D model at a second level of detail that is lower than the first level of detail, and applying the dynamic lightmap at the first level of detail to the 3D model rendered at the second level of detail. Corresponding systems are also disclosed.
